Abstract

JPEG Pleno is an upcoming standard from the ISO/IEC JTC 1/SC 29/WG 1 (JPEG) Committee, aiming to provide a standard framework for coding new imaging modalities derived from representations inspired by the plenoptic function. Within JPEG Pleno, the light field coding part (JPEG Pleno Part 2) standardizes light field coding technologies, considering the light field modelled as a 2D array of 2D views. Two coding modes are defined: one exploiting the redundancy using a 4D prediction scheme; and the other exploiting the inherent 4D redundancy in 4D light field data utilizing a 4D transform technique. This talk will present and discuss the two independent light field coding modes.

Biography

Carla L. Pagliari received the Ph.D. degree in Electronic Systems Engineering from the University of Essex, U.K., in 2000. In 1983 and 1985 she was with TV Globo, Rio de Janeiro, Brazil. From 1986 to 1992 she was a Researcher with the Instituto de Pesquisa e Desenvolvimento, Rio de Janeiro, Brazil. Since 1993 she has been a Senior Researcher and a Professor with the Department of Electrical Engineering at the Military Institute of Engineering (IME), Rio de Janeiro, Brazil.

She is a member of the ISO/IEC JTC1/SC29/WG1 (JPEG) standardization committee, of the Brazilian delegation for the WG1 JPEG activities, and of the Board of Teaching of the Brazilian Society of Television Engineering. Her main research activities and interests are focused on light field signal processing and coding, image and video processing, and computer vision. She is a Senior Member of IEEE and serves as an expert on the JPEG Pleno committee since January 2018.
